XPolygonRegion(3)         XLIB FUNCTIONS        XPolygonRegion(3)



NAME
       XPolygonRegion, XClipBox - generate regions

SYNTAX
       Region XPolygonRegion(XPoint points[], int n, int
              fill_rule);

       int XClipBox(Region r, XRectangle *rect_return);

ARGUMENTS
       fill_rule Specifies the fill-rule you want to set for the
                 specified GC.  You can pass EvenOddRule or Wind-
                 ingRule.

       n         Specifies the number of points in the polygon.

       points    Specifies an array of points.

       r         Specifies the region.

       rect_return
                 Returns the smallest enclosing rectangle.

DESCRIPTION
       The XPolygonRegion function returns a region for the poly-
       gon defined by the points array.  For an explanation of
       fill_rule, see XCreateGC.

       The XClipBox function returns the smallest rectangle
       enclosing the specified region.
